Irish Rose
Channel
327k views

Country: USA

Profile hits: 53,898

Subscribers: 661

Total video views: 327,034

Region: Washington

City: Lynnwood

Signed up: July 15, 2022 (1,346 days ago)

Worked for/with: Irish Rose

404 Not Found

404 Not Found


nginx